首頁  >  文章  >  後端開發  >  c語言中x-=是什麼意思

c語言中x-=是什麼意思

下次还敢
下次还敢原創
2024-04-13 19:00:43503瀏覽

在 C 語言中,x-= 運算子將 x 目前值減去 1,等同於 x = x - 1,用於簡化程式碼,增加可讀性和簡潔性。其他複合賦值運算子還包括: =、*=、/=、%=、<<=、>>=、&=、|=、^=.

c語言中x-=是什麼意思

c語言中x-= 的意思

在C 語言中,x-= 運算子是複合賦值運算符,它等同於x = x - 1。

操作方式

x-= 運算子將變數 x 的目前值減去 1,並將結果重新儲存在 x 中。

語法

<code class="c">x -= 1;</code>

範例

<code class="c">int x = 5;

x -= 1; // 等同于 x = x - 1

printf("x 的值现在为: %d\n", x); // 输出 4</code>

優點

複合賦值運算符可以簡化程式碼,使其更具可讀性和簡潔性。

其他複合賦值運算子

C 語言也提供了其他複合賦值運算符,包括:

  • =:新增一個值
  • -=:減去一個值
  • *=:乘以一個值
  • /=:除以一個值
  • %=:求餘一個值
  • <<=:左移一個值
  • =:右移一個值
  • ##&= :位元與一個值
  • |=:位元或一個值
  • ^=:位元異或一個值
  • #

以上是c語言中x-=是什麼意思的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n